What are the best practices for securing APIs against unauthorized access?

Securing APIs against unauthorized access involves implementing robust authentication, authorization, and encryption measures to protect data and ensure only legitimate users can interact with the API. Adhering to frameworks like OWASP API Security Top 10 can guide the implementation of these security controls effectively.
Example Concept: Implement OAuth 2.0 for secure authentication and authorization, ensuring that tokens are used to validate user access. Use HTTPS to encrypt data in transit, and apply rate limiting to prevent abuse. Regularly audit API endpoints for vulnerabilities and enforce strong input validation to mitigate injection attacks.

- Use API gateways to centralize security controls and monitoring.
- Regularly update and patch API software to fix known vulnerabilities.
- Implement logging and monitoring to detect and respond to suspicious activities.
- Consider using mutual TLS for enhanced security in sensitive API communications.
